Introduction: Current Situation of Global Vanadium Pentoxide Market

Vanadium Pentoxide (V₂O₅) is one of the most important vanadium compounds used in modern metallurgy, chemical industries, and emerging energy storage applications.

As a key raw material for producing ferrovanadium, vanadium-nitrogen alloy, and other vanadium-based materials, Vanadium Pentoxide plays an important role in improving steel strength, toughness, corrosion resistance, and overall performance.

In recent years, the global Vanadium Pentoxide market has experienced continuous changes due to several factors, including:

fluctuations in steel production;

changes in vanadium raw material supply;

energy and transportation costs;

increasing demand from renewable energy storage systems;

international trade conditions.

The V2O5 Price Trend has therefore become an important concern for steel mills, ferroalloy manufacturers, distributors, and industrial buyers worldwide.

2. Main Factors Influencing Vanadium Pentoxide Price Trend

2.1 Steel Industry Demand

The steel industry remains the largest consumption area for vanadium products.

During steel production, Vanadium Pentoxide is converted into:

Ferrovanadium (FeV)

which is added into steel to improve:

  • tensile strength;
  • wear resistance;
  • toughness;

grain refinement ability.

High-strength low-alloy steel (HSLA steel) is widely used in:

  • construction;
  • automotive manufacturing;
  • pipelines;

engineering equipment.

Therefore, when global steel production increases, demand for Vanadium Pentoxide usually strengthens.

Conversely, when steel demand slows down, vanadium consumption may decrease, creating pressure on V2O5 prices.


2.2 Raw Material Supply and Production Cost

The supply chain of Vanadium Pentoxide depends on several raw materials:

  • vanadium titanomagnetite;
  • vanadium slag;
  • petroleum residue;
  • industrial waste containing vanadium.

Production costs are affected by:

Energy Cost

Vanadium processing requires:

  • roasting;
  • extraction;
  • purification;
  • calcination processes.

Higher electricity and fuel costs can increase the production cost of V₂O₅.

Raw Material Availability

When vanadium-containing raw materials become limited, suppliers may reduce production output, affecting market supply.

This can create upward pressure on:

Vanadium Pentoxide Market Price.


2.3 Energy Storage Industry Creates New Demand

One of the most important future growth areas for vanadium is:

Vanadium Redox Flow Battery (VRFB)

VRFB technology has advantages including:

  • long cycle life;
  • high safety;
  • flexible capacity expansion;
  • suitability for large-scale energy storage.

As renewable energy projects expand globally, demand for vanadium electrolyte materials may increase.

This creates additional market support for:

High Purity Vanadium Pentoxide.

Compared with traditional steel consumption, energy storage demand is still developing, but many market participants consider it an important long-term growth driver.

5. How Vanadium Pentoxide Suppliers Determine Quotations

When buyers request a quotation for Vanadium Pentoxide, suppliers usually consider several factors.

5.1 Product Specification

The most common specification is:

Vanadium Pentoxide Flakes 98% Min

Typical requirements include:

Item Requirement
V₂O₅ Content ≥98%
Appearance Green / Yellow-green flakes
Moisture Controlled
Packaging Industrial standard

Higher purity materials usually have higher prices.

Examples:

  • 98% V₂O₅
  • 99% V₂O₅
  • Battery-grade V₂O₅

5.2 Order Quantity (MOQ)

The MOQ (Minimum Order Quantity) affects the final quotation.

Typical industrial purchasing:

Trial order: small quantity available depending on supplier stock

Regular order: several tons

Bulk order: container quantity

Large-volume buyers usually receive more competitive prices because:

production scheduling is easier;

transportation cost per ton decreases;

packaging efficiency improves.


5.3 Delivery Time

The delivery time of Vanadium Pentoxide flakes depends on:

  • inventory availability;
  • production schedule;
  • inspection requirements;
  • destination country.

Typical lead time:

  • Stock products: around 7-15 days
  • Production orders: around 15-30 days
  • For long-term customers, suppliers usually arrange:
  • reserved production capacity;
  • stable shipment schedules;
  • regular supply agreements.

6. Vanadium Pentoxide Packaging Requirements

Proper packaging is important because V₂O₅ is an industrial chemical material requiring protection during transportation.

Common packaging methods include:

25kg Plastic Bags + Woven Bags

Advantages:

  • easy handling;
  • suitable for standard export;
  • good protection.

Steel Drums

Used for customers requiring:

  • higher protection;
  • long-distance transportation;
  • strict storage conditions.

Pallet Packaging

For international shipping, suppliers may use:

  • wooden pallets;
  • wrapped pallets;
  • reinforced packaging.

Export packaging usually includes:

  • product name;
  • batch number;
  • net weight;
  • manufacturer information;
  • inspection certificate.

7. Vanadium Pentoxide Storage Requirements

Correct storage helps maintain product quality and prevents contamination.

Recommended Storage Conditions:

Dry Warehouse

Vanadium Pentoxide should be stored in a dry and ventilated warehouse.

  • Avoid:
  • rain;
  • humidity;
  • direct water contact.

Original Sealed Packaging

Keep products in original packaging until use.

This prevents:

  • moisture absorption;
  • contamination;
  • packaging damage.

Separate Storage

Avoid storing together with:

  • strong acids;
  • incompatible chemicals;
  • materials that may cause contamination.
